COPELAND Borough Council has welcomed a new Pride of Place operative to its team.
Darren Glover has begun cleaning up the streets of Copeland alongside Malcolm Litt.
The pair collected 187 bags of rubbish, weeds and debris over five days from areas in Whitehaven, Frizington, Cleator Moor and Egremont.
Mr Glover brings a wealth of local knowledge and experience to the role having joined the council’s parks and open spaces team in April 2018.
The duo undertake duties such as litter picking, weeding, emptying bins and general cleaning of the borough’s towns and villages.
Mr Glover said: “It’s a great opportunity and I look forward to keeping our town nice and clean.”
Mike Starkie, Mayor of Copeland, launched the Copeland Pride of Place campaign in January to highlight everything that is positive in the borough.
